Stars

Icon

Renewable Diesel Production Expansion

Vertex Energy's strategic push into renewable diesel, notably at its Mobile facility, places it firmly in the Stars quadrant of the BCG Matrix. This segment is characterized by high market growth, driven by increasing demand for sustainable fuels. In 2024, Vertex announced plans to further invest in its renewable diesel capabilities, signaling a strong commitment to capturing market share in this expanding sector.

Cash Cows

Icon

Conventional Refined Products

Vertex Energy's conventional refined products segment, which includes fuels like gasoline and diesel, is a prime example of a cash cow. These operations are well-established, meaning they are in a mature market where Vertex has a solid footing. This maturity translates into consistent revenue generation with minimal need for substantial new investments to drive growth.

The company's focus here is on maximizing profitability through operational excellence and efficient market management. In 2023, Vertex Energy reported that its refining segment, which includes these conventional products, generated $1.4 billion in revenue. This segment is crucial for funding other areas of the business and providing stable returns.

Icon

Used Motor Oil Re-refining Operations

Vertex Energy's used motor oil re-refining operations are a classic cash cow. This business segment, a cornerstone of Vertex's long-standing operations, thrives in a mature market where supply and demand for re-refined oil remain consistently strong.

Vertex's established infrastructure and deep market penetration in this area enable it to consistently produce reliable and predictable cash flows. For instance, in 2023, Vertex reported that its re-refining segment generated significant revenue, contributing substantially to its overall financial health.

These re-refining activities demand very little in terms of new growth investments, with the primary focus being on optimizing operational efficiency and maintaining existing capacity. This strategic emphasis allows Vertex to maximize profitability from this mature business line.

Icon

Base Lubricant Production from Re-refining

Base lubricant production from re-refining is a classic cash cow for Vertex Energy. This segment benefits from a stable industrial market where demand for lubricants remains consistent. Vertex's existing capacity and commitment to quality likely secure a significant market share.

This product line generates reliable profits and cash flow without requiring substantial new investment for growth. For instance, in 2023, Vertex reported that its re-refining operations processed 25 million gallons of used oil, a testament to its established capacity. This steady income stream is crucial for funding other areas of the business.
